READING THE PRIMARY TEXTS
You have to read your primary texts. Unfortunately, referring to SparkNotes alone will no longer suffice. As reading primary resources requires an extensive level of self-discipline.
You have to read the primary source in order to successfully argue your claims in a literature essay. Ensure you set weekly reading goals for yourself.
